Nepal, June 2 -- The Sudurpaschim Province government has adopted a policy to prioritize the completion of provincial pride projects by allocating budgets based on a project prioritization procedure and a project bank. It will also make project selection and prioritization more result-oriented.

The policies and programmes presented by Province Chief Najir Miya in the Province Assembly on Monday for the fiscal year 2026/27 underscore sectoral projects, taking into account the achievements of the province's first five-year plan, the goals and priorities set by the second five-year plan, and the current periodic plan of the federal government. The budget will seek to balance these aspects.
